  • Administrators Posts: 53,385 Admin ✭✭✭✭✭awec


    DaveyDave wrote: »
    Is the amount received all of your PAYE paid after tax credits in the last 4 years or is it a certain percentage of it?

    I'm getting figures from the taxes deducted in the PAYE section on the P21 and mine is near the 5% max, it just seems a bit high for something that actually benefits us...

    All tax.

    5% of the house value or the amount of income tax you've paid (minus PRSI and USC) in the past 4 years, up to a max of 20k.

  • Registered Users Posts: 271 ✭✭tomister


    tolow wrote: »
    Hi,

    I tried submitting an application this evening and when selecting 2016 and 2017 it is saying I have not filed a Form 12 for these years even though I have a p21 for each of these years. Anyone had this issue?

    I had the same problem - the Form 12 is a statement of liability. If you've no other income to declare its a straight forward process. Just go to statement of liability and submit it for the relevant years.
    You'll actually get another P21 at the end of it all but then you can go ahead with the HTB application

  • Registered Users Posts: 290 ✭✭JimmiesRustled


    Motivator wrote: »
    Our joint/group application was approved today. When I logged in under my account it’s shows the value of my claim to be x and then when my girlfriend logs into her revenue account it shows an amount almost double what’s showing for mine. The same application number and access code is showing on both accounts.

    What does this mean? The total value of the two claim values is just over €20,000, are we entitled to €20,000 in total as in both mine and her claim values are added together or do we just use the higher value I.e hers?

    If the amount you've been granted is equal to or above the €20,000 then you can avail of a maximum of €20,000.

    It depends. It's based on the lesser value. So for instance if the house you're buying is €320,000, 5% of this would be €16,000. So even though you might be able in theory to get the full €20,000 it's based on the house you're looking to purchase.

    As I mentioned previously it's up to €20,000 or 5% of the value of the house, whichever is the lesser value.
